About Stob na Broige

Stob na Bròige stands proudly at the Glen Etive terminus of the iconic Buachaille Etive Mòr. Elevated to the status of a separate Munro in 1997, this peak has since become a must-visit for avid munro baggers. The reclassification encourages enthusiasts to undertake a full traverse of the ridge, offering a more comprehensive and rewarding hiking experience. Where is Stob na Broige?

Stob na Broige sits in the Loch Linnhe to Loch Etive region of Fort William at 56.6299°N, 4.9512°W.

Key facts

Height 953 metres / 3,128 feet
Rank by height 210 of 282 Munros
Coordinates 56.62988, -4.95116
Group Buachaille Etive Mor
Area Fort William
SMC section 03B: Loch Linnhe to Loch Etive
